Sporting CP announced on Saturday the signing of Brazilian goalkeeper Kaique Pereira from Palmeiras. The young keeper, 21 years old, is the latest addition for the Portuguese club in the goalkeeper position.
Kaique Pereira has experience in Portuguese football, having played for two clubs in the Portuguese League: Farense and Nacional. This is not his first experience outside Brazil, which gives him some adaptation to European football.
The 21-year-old player arrives at Sporting to strengthen the Lions' goal, joining the other goalkeepers in the squad. The announcement was made by the Portuguese top-flight club, which did not reveal the financial details of the transfer.
